The printing press renaissance marked a decisive shift in how ideas were shaped, stored, and shared across Europe. Artisans merged craft traditions with emerging sciences to build machines that turned manuscript culture into a scalable information ecosystem.
From movable metal type to precision mechanics and collaborative publishing networks, this era redefined readership, authority, and innovation itself.

Mechanics and Materials of Movable Type
Alloy Composition and Mold Precision
Type founders refined lead-antimony-tin alloys to balance hardness against wear. Accurate punches and matrices ensured consistent letterforms, reducing errors and waste during high-volume runs.
Press Design and Power Transfer
The screw press borrowed from wine and paper pressing adapted human leverage into controlled pressure. Platen, bed, and tympan alignment determined uniform ink density and sharp impressions.
Ink, Paper, and Distribution Networks
Oil-modified inks dried cleanly on porous rag paper, supporting fine strokes and stacked drying. Guilds, stationers, and maritime routes transported books from urban ateliers to regional courts and merchant houses.
Craftsmanship, Economics, and Urban Growth
Workshop Organization and Specialization
Printers, punch cutters, composers, and pressmen operated in coordinated workflows. Apprenticeships and detailed ledgers tracked materials, labor hours, and royalties, laying foundations for modern production accounting.
Patents, Privileges, and Market Regulation
Royal and episcopal privileges shaped who could print and at what scale. Licensing reduced unauthorized editions, while privilege systems incentivized investment in costly fonts and presses.
Book Markets and Social Circulation
Price tiers, subscription catalogs, and auction broadsides connected readers to varied content. Port books, credit notes, and multilingual editions reveal a vibrant cross-border trade that fueled urban printing economies.
Dissemination of Knowledge and Cultural Shifts
Standardization and Error Management
Correctors compared manuscripts with proofs to stabilize texts, yet misprints persisted and became part of bibliographical study. Variant states and cancel leaves document how printed authority was continuously negotiated.
Cross-Lingual Exchange and Vernacular Printing
Beyond Latin, printers issued grammars, dictionaries, and legal manuals in local languages. This lowered entry to law, theology, and natural philosophy, widening literate publics and accelerating technical innovation.

How did movable type transform the speed and scale of information sharing compared to manuscript culture?
Movable type enabled the rapid reset of pages, allowing thousands of copies from a single set of forms, whereas scribes copied texts individually, making mass duplication slow and costly.
What role did guild structures play in controlling early printing shops and protecting quality?
Printer guilds enforced standards, limited unauthorized entrants, and mediated disputes, ensuring consistent craftsmanship while also restricting competition and innovation outside official channels.
In what ways did printing influence political authority and the spread of reform movements across Europe?
Printed pamphlets and vernacular scriptures allowed reformers to bypass ecclesiastical gatekeepers, turning theological questions into public debates and reshaping the balance between institutional power and lay literacy.
What technical challenges did early printers face in ink formulation, paper selection, and press mechanics?
Balancing ink oil content, drying time, and type durability, sourcing consistent rag paper, and aligning press components under high pressure required iterative experimentation to avoid blurred impressions and costly waste.
